Transaction d84640700077f08ea95c68a71238479f9b1de51ffac98f6778303d172c47a955

1 Input
2 Outputs
  • d84640700077f08ea95c68a71238479f9b1de51ffac98f6778303d172c47a955:0
  • value  133608
    address  3FiFbKWspN3v4RBbc2s2vitTy1o1jJLmL8
  • d84640700077f08ea95c68a71238479f9b1de51ffac98f6778303d172c47a955:1
  • value  915
    address  382e3eEMdQ8xKpNyw6tjLmSEKUEuTBFxP8